Sports are often celebrated as a display of skill, talent, and effort. However, beneath the surface of every great performance or remarkable achievement lies a set of less obvious yet crucial principles that drive success. These hidden rules are not always discussed openly, but they shape the outcomes of countless athletes, teams, and individuals in the world of sports. In this blog post, we’ll explore these often-overlooked rules and how they contribute to achieving peak performance.

1. Preparation is the Foundation

One of the most overlooked yet critical aspects of success in sports is preparation. Many people assume that talent alone will lead to victory, but in reality, preparation goes hand in hand with it. A well-prepared athlete knows their strengths and weaknesses, has a clear game plan, and stays focused during competitions. Preparation involves not just physical conditioning but also mental readiness—knowing when to push through fatigue or when to adjust strategies.

For example, consider a sprinter preparing for a world-class race. Their training isn’t just about building speed; it’s also about understanding their biomechanics, nutrition, and recovery techniques. Without this preparation, even the most gifted athlete might struggle to perform at their best.

2. Mental Strength: Beyond Just Endurance

Success in sports is rarely attributed solely to physical prowess or strategic planning. A crucial yet often-unmentioned factor is mental strength—the ability to stay calm under pressure and maintain focus during high-stakes moments. Athletes who can manage stress, make split-second decisions, and remain composed are far more likely to succeed than those who panic.

Take Tiger Woods, for instance. His success on the golf course isn’t just about his skills; it’s also about his resilience and ability to handle criticism gracefully. In high-pressure situations, mental strength allows athletes to push through fear and maintain their performance.

3. Adaptability: The Art of Adjusting

Sports are dynamic environments that require constant adaptation. Every day brings new challenges—new opponents, changing playing conditions, or even shifts in team dynamics. Successful athletes understand the importance of staying flexible and open-minded when things don’t go as planned.

Consider the coach of a winning football team. Instead of getting defensive about their record, they focus on learning from each game to improve for the next season. Adaptability isn’t just about adjusting to opponents; it’s about evolving one’s own approach to maximize effectiveness.

4. Teamwork: The Power of Collaboration

While individual talent is essential in sports, the ability to work well with teammates is often overlooked. Effective teamwork involves communication, trust, and a shared commitment to achieving a common goal. Athletes who thrive in team sports understand that their success depends not just on their own abilities but also on how they interact with others.

5. Work Ethic: Beyond Just Showing Up

A successful athlete often attributes their achievements to more than just talent or natural ability. Many attribute their success to an unwavering work ethic—a commitment to improving every day, pushing through challenges, and never settling for less than their best. This mindset translates into consistent effort, dedication, and persistence.

For instance, consider a marathon runner who finishes a world record. It’s not just about physical endurance; it’s also about mental discipline—pushing beyond one’s limits, enduring grueling training regimens, and maintaining focus over hours of intense competition.

6. Resilience: The Power of Recovery

True success in sports comes after overcoming obstacles—whether it’s injuries, failure, or tough losses. Resilient athletes understand that setbacks are part of the journey and use them as opportunities to grow stronger. Effective recovery strategies help athletes manage physical strain and maintain peak performance despite temporary setbacks.

A marathon runner who sustains an injury knows that they must adapt their training to avoid further harm while continuing to build strength and endurance. This ability to bounce back is crucial for sustaining success over the long term.

7. Focus: The Key to Consistency

In a sport where time management often dictates performance, the ability to stay focused in the moment can mean the difference between victory and defeat. Athletes who maintain focus are better equipped to execute their strategies flawlessly during games or races. This focus is honed through practice, discipline, and mental preparation.

Imagine a swimmer competing in an Olympic event. Their entire strategy revolves around staying calm, focusing on their breathing, and maintaining proper form. Any distraction—be it fear of the crowd or uncertainty about their performance—can throw off their execution.

8. Timing: The Art of Knowing When to Act

Knowing when to act is as crucial in sports as knowing when not to. Athletes who act too quickly or make impulsive decisions often fall short of their potential, while those who wait for the right moment can achieve remarkable results. 9. Diversity: The Strength of Multiple Talents

No two athletes are the same, and recognizing this diversity is key to achieving optimal success. A successful team or sport often thrives on having players with different strengths—whether it’s versatility in a game, adaptability during training, or unique skills that complement others.

Consider a cricket team with players who have different roles but work together seamlessly. Their combined expertise allows them to tackle any challenge thrown their way. Diversity of talent isn’t just about looking different; it’s about harnessing the strengths of each individual to achieve a common goal.

10. Relationships: The Foundation of Success

In sports, the relationships between athletes and coaches, teammates, or managers play a pivotal role in achieving success. Open lines of communication, trust, and mutual respect are essential for fostering teamwork and ensuring that everyone is aligned with shared goals.

A successful basketball team often relies on strong relationships among players to keep morale high during tough stretches. These connections help reduce tension and create an environment where everyone feels comfortable taking risks and pushing boundaries.

11. Patience: The Key to Long-Term Success

Finally, patience is a rare trait in today’s fast-paced world of sports. Successful athletes know that they must remain patient with their progress, allowing their efforts to bear fruit without getting discouraged by setbacks. This patience leads to long-term success and helps them avoid the pitfalls of chasing immediate results.

For example, a marathon runner who sets an ambitious personal best may struggle during training but remains patient with themselves as they work towards higher goals. This persistence ensures that they continue improving over time despite occasional plateaus or regressions in performance.

Conclusion

Success in sports is rarely a matter of just talent or effort—it’s often the result of a carefully balanced mix of preparation, mental strength, adaptability, teamwork, work ethic, resilience, focus, timing, diversity, relationships, patience, and persistence. These hidden rules form the foundation upon which success is built, making them essential for anyone looking to excel in their sport.

While individual talent plays a role, it’s these less obvious yet crucial principles that give athletes the edge they need to thrive. By understanding and applying these hidden rules, you can not only improve your performance but also lay the groundwork for long-term success in sports and beyond.
